« Return to Thread: can not autodetect the dialect

Re: can not autodetect the dialect

by mvadlamudi1 :: Rate this Message:

Reply to Author | View in Thread


snow75 wrote:
I upgraded the jdbc to ojbc6.jar , I used the following link:
http://www.oracle.com/technology/software/tech/java/sqlj_jdbc/htdocs/jdbc_111060.htmland
it Works !!!! thank you so much guys ...

2008/11/17 ilazaar ilazaar <ilazaar@gmail.com>

> ok thanks cédric, i'm doing it ... I will let you know
>
>
> 2008/11/17 Cédric Munger <cedric.munger@gmail.com>
>
> Give a try to version 10.2.0.4 at
>> http://www.oracle.com/technology/software/tech/java/sqlj_jdbc/htdocs/jdbc_10201.html
>> Please don't forget to recreate the database from scratch. Maybe that the
>> old driver did some mess in the data of the current one.
>>
>> Regards
>>
>>
>> On Mon, Nov 17, 2008 at 4:53 PM, Cédric Munger <cedric.munger@gmail.com>wrote:
>>
>>> OK got an hint for you : to my knowledge, the message 'streams type
>>> cannot be used in batching' indicates that you're using an old oracle JDBC
>>> driver version. Try to upgrade it and it should fix the issue. Please let us
>>> know.
>>>
>>> Regards
>>>
>>>
>>> On Mon, Nov 17, 2008 at 4:31 PM, ilazaar ilazaar <ilazaar@gmail.com>wrote:
>>>
>>>> i'm using Oracle Database 10*g* Express Edition and ojdbc14 and I got
>>>> the following errors too if it helps:
>>>>
>>>> [pmd:cpd]
>>>> [INFO]
>>>> ------------------------------------------------------------------------
>>>> [INFO] Building B4ONE
>>>> [INFO]    task-segment:
>>>> [org.codehaus.sonar:sonar-core-maven-plugin:1.4.3:collect]
>>>> [INFO]
>>>> ------------------------------------------------------------------------
>>>> [INFO] snapshot org.codehaus.sonar.runtime:jdbc-driver:1.0-SNAPSHOT:
>>>> checking for updates from sonar
>>>> [INFO] snapshot
>>>> org.codehaus.sonar.runtime.jdbc-driver:jdbc-driver_ext_0:1.0-SNAPSHOT:
>>>> checking for updates from sonar
>>>> [INFO] snapshot org.codehaus.sonar.runtime:plugins:1.0-SNAPSHOT:
>>>> checking for updates from sonar
>>>> [INFO] snapshot
>>>> org.codehaus.sonar.runtime.plugins:plugins_ext_0:1.0-SNAPSHOT: checking for
>>>> updates from sonar
>>>> [INFO] snapshot
>>>> org.codehaus.sonar.runtime.plugins:plugins_ext_1:1.0-SNAPSHOT: checking for
>>>> updates from sonar
>>>> [INFO] snapshot
>>>> org.codehaus.sonar.runtime.plugins:plugins_ext_2:1.0-SNAPSHOT: checking for
>>>> updates from sonar
>>>> [INFO] snapshot
>>>> org.codehaus.sonar.runtime.plugins:plugins_ext_3:1.0-SNAPSHOT: checking for
>>>> updates from sonar
>>>> [INFO] [sonar-core:collect]
>>>> 16:11:23.831 WARN  o.h.util.JDBCExceptionReporter - SQL Error: 17090,
>>>> SQLState: null
>>>> 16:11:23.832 ERROR o.h.util.JDBCExceptionReporter - opération interdite:
>>>> streams type cannot be used in batching
>>>> 16:11:23.833 ERROR o.h.e.d.AbstractFlushingEventListener - Could not
>>>> synchronize database state with session
>>>> org.hibernate.exception.GenericJDBCException: could not insert:
>>>> [ch.hortis.sonar.model.SnapshotSource]
>>>>     at
>>>> org.hibernate.exception.SQLStateConverter.handledNonSpecificException(SQLStateConverter.java:103)
>>>>     at
>>>> org.hibernate.exception.SQLStateConverter.convert(SQLStateConverter.java:91)
>>>>     at
>>>> org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:43)
>>>>     at
>>>> org.hibernate.persister.entity.AbstractEntityPersister.insert(AbstractEntityPersister.java:2272)
>>>>     at
>>>> org.hibernate.persister.entity.AbstractEntityPersister.insert(AbstractEntityPersister.java:2665)
>>>>     at
>>>> org.hibernate.action.EntityInsertAction.execute(EntityInsertAction.java:60)
>>>>     at org.hibernate.engine.ActionQueue.execute(ActionQueue.java:279)
>>>>     at
>>>> org.hibernate.engine.ActionQueue.executeActions(ActionQueue.java:263)
>>>>     at
>>>> org.hibernate.engine.ActionQueue.executeActions(ActionQueue.java:167)
>>>>     at
>>>> org.hibernate.event.def.AbstractFlushingEventListener.performExecutions(AbstractFlushingEventListener.java:298)
>>>>     at
>>>> org.hibernate.event.def.DefaultFlushEventListener.onFlush(DefaultFlushEventListener.java:27)
>>>>     at org.hibernate.impl.SessionImpl.flush(SessionImpl.java:1000)
>>>>     at
>>>> org.hibernate.ejb.AbstractEntityManagerImpl.flush(AbstractEntityManagerImpl.java:297)
>>>>     at
>>>> org.sonar.commons.database.BatchDatabaseManager.flush(BatchDatabaseManager.java:115)
>>>>     at
>>>> org.sonar.commons.database.BatchDatabaseManager.save(BatchDatabaseManager.java:84)
>>>>     at
>>>> org.sonar.plugins.java.JavaMeasuresRecorder.createClassSource(JavaMeasuresRecorder.java:80)
>>>>     at
>>>> org.sonar.plugins.sources.SourcesJavaMavenCollector.parseDirectory(SourcesJavaMavenCollector.java:66)
>>>>     at
>>>> org.sonar.plugins.sources.SourcesJavaMavenCollector.collect(SourcesJavaMavenCollector.java:51)
>>>>     at org.sonar.maven.CollectMojo.doExecute(CollectMojo.java:73)
>>>>
>>>>     at ch.hortis.sonar.mvn.CoreMojo.execute(CoreMojo.java:130)
>>>>     at
>>>> org.apache.maven.plugin.DefaultPluginManager.executeMojo(DefaultPluginManager.java:451)
>>>>     at
>>>> org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oals(DefaultLifecycleExecutor.java:558)
>>>>     at
>>>> org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eStandaloneGoal(DefaultLifecycleExecutor.java:512)
>>>>     at
>>>> org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oal(DefaultLifecycleExecutor.java:482)
>>>>     at
>>>> org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oalAndHandleFailures(DefaultLifecycleExecutor.java:330)
>>>>     at
>>>> org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eTaskSegments(DefaultLifecycleExecutor.java:291)
>>>>     at
>>>> org.apache.maven.lifecycle.DefaultLifecycleExecutor.execute(DefaultLifecycleExecutor.java:142)
>>>>     at
>>>> ch.hortis.sonar.mvn.SonarMavenEmbedder.execute(SonarMavenEmbedder.java:151)
>>>>     at ch.hortis.sonar.mvn.SonarMojo.executeMaven(SonarMojo.java:248)
>>>>     at ch.hortis.sonar.mvn.SonarMojo.executeGoals(SonarMojo.java:231)
>>>>     at ch.hortis.sonar.mvn.SonarMojo.execute(SonarMojo.java:116)
>>>>     at
>>>> org.apache.maven.plugin.DefaultPluginManager.executeMojo(DefaultPluginManager.java:451)
>>>>     at
>>>> org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oals(DefaultLifecycleExecutor.java:558)
>>>>     at
>>>> org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eStandaloneGoal(DefaultLifecycleExecutor.java:512)
>>>>     at
>>>> org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oal(DefaultLifecycleExecutor.java:482)
>>>>     at
>>>> org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oalAndHandleFailures(DefaultLifecycleExecutor.java:330)
>>>>     at
>>>> org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eTaskSegments(DefaultLifecycleExecutor.java:227)
>>>>     at
>>>> org.apache.maven.lifecycle.DefaultLifecycleExecutor.execute(DefaultLifecycleExecutor.java:142)
>>>>     at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:336)
>>>>     at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:129)
>>>>     at org.apache.maven.cli.MavenCli.main(MavenCli.java:287)
>>>>     at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>>>>     at
>>>> s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
>>>>     at
>>>> s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
>>>>     at java.lang.reflect.Method.invoke(Method.java:597)
>>>>     at
>>>> org.codehaus.classworlds.Launcher.launchEnhanced(Launcher.java:315)
>>>>     at org.codehaus.classworlds.Launcher.launch(Launcher.java:255)
>>>>     at
>>>> org.codehaus.classworlds.Launcher.mainWithExitCode(Launcher.java:430)
>>>>     at org.codehaus.classworlds.Launcher.main(Launcher.java:375)
>>>> Caused by: java.sql.SQLException: opération interdite: streams type
>>>> cannot be used in batching
>>>>     at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:134)
>>>>     at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:179)
>>>>     at
>>>> oracle.jdbc.driver.OraclePreparedStatement.addBatch(OraclePreparedStatement.java:3999)
>>>>     at
>>>> org.hibernate.jdbc.BatchingBatcher.addToBatch(BatchingBatcher.java:31)
>>>>     at
>>>> org.hibernate.persister.entity.AbstractEntityPersister.insert(AbstractEntityPersister.java:2252)
>>>>     ... 45 common frames omitted
>>>> 16:11:23.858 WARN  o.h.util.JDBCExceptionReporter - SQL Error: 1,
>>>> SQLState: 23000
>>>> 16:11:23.858 ERROR o.h.util.JDBCExceptionReporter - ORA-00001: violation
>>>> de contrainte unique (SONAR.SYS_C004093)
>>>>
>>>> 16:11:23.858 WARN  o.h.util.JDBCExceptionReporter - SQL Error: 1,
>>>> SQLState: 23000
>>>> 16:11:23.858 ERROR o.h.util.JDBCExceptionReporter - ORA-00001: violation
>>>> de contrainte unique (SONAR.SYS_C004093)
>>>>
>>>> .....
>>>>
>>>>
>>>> 2008/11/17 Simon Brandhof <simon.brandhof@sonarsource.com>
>>>>
>>>>> What are your database and driver versions ?
>>>>>
>>>>> ---------------------------------------------------------------------
>>>>> To unsubscribe from this list, please visit:
>>>>>
>>>>>    http://xircles.codehaus.org/manage_email
>>>>>
>>>>>
>>>>>
>>>>
>>>
>>
>

Hi

i am also having the same issue,

please any one can provide the solution.

 « Return to Thread: can not autodetect the dialect